12 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Longstanding'

The longstanding friendship between Sarah and Emily grew stronger over the years.

The family celebrated their longstanding tradition of hosting a summer barbecue every year.

The longstanding debate over immigration policies continues to shape political discussions.

The teacher received a longstanding service award for dedicated years of educating students.

Despite the longstanding challenges, the community worked together to revitalize the neighborhood.

The scientist made groundbreaking discoveries by building on the longstanding principles of physics.

The novel explored the longstanding conflict between tradition and modernity in a small village.

The longstanding friendship between Sarah and Emily remained unshaken despite the distance.

The bookstore has been a longstanding fixture in our neighborhood, serving generations of readers.

Despite facing challenges, their longstanding commitment to environmental conservation never wavered.

The longstanding debate over the importance of space exploration continues among scientists.

The longstanding policy of promoting diversity has contributed to the company's success.
